#7fdc63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7fdc63 is composed of 49.8% red, 86.3%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 55%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 106.1 degrees, a saturation of 63.4% and a lightness of 62.5%. #7fdc63 color hex could be obtained by blending #feffc6 with #00b900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#7fdc63 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7fdc63 has RGB values of R:127, G:220,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 8379491.
